Card disappears on no departures

When there is no departures for a station, the card disappears completely, even if several entities were assigned to the card, and some of them still have departures

My config is:

type: custom:hvv-card
entities:
  - sensor.borstelmannsweg_133_departures
  - sensor.schadesweg_departures

When the last 530 has departed, the card fails to render

Delay is treated as hours

If there is a delay. The card shows it as hours.
E.g.
8 minutes delayed on the hvv website are +480minutes in the card.
